Output f5de39dcdd151c5ecc9044af7083e2f54f1f36dc81fefa6bdfcf0f4232e68b0f:4

value
8053224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8863d3f5fced41383a52bb1ca59d367189a0cc6d OP_EQUAL
address
3E8BQoTWZuiodRGyPXY4dxQfbSgStBkC9y
transaction
f5de39dcdd151c5ecc9044af7083e2f54f1f36dc81fefa6bdfcf0f4232e68b0f
confirmations
357286
spent
true